About Bucks Green

Bucks Green, a quiet corner of West Sussex, hums with the subtle life of the countryside. It lies 9.5 km west-north-west of Horsham (from Horsham: bearing 286°T, OS grid TQ 079 329), and is situated south-west of Rudgwick village.
